Waldport was not able to break out of their rough patch on Monday as the team picked up their fifth straight loss dating back to last season. They fell 10-6 to the Lowell Devils. That's two games in a row now that the Irish have lost by exactly four runs.

Azura Prince made the most of her time at bat despite the final result and scored a run and stole two bases while going 3-for-4.

Even though they lost, Waldport was getting hits left and right and finished the game having posted a batting average of .406. They easily outclassed their opponents in that department as Lowell only posted a batting average of .261.

Waldport's defeat dropped their record down to 0-2.

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Waldport will host Powers at 4:30 p.m. on April 1. As for Lowell, they will be playing in front of their home fans against Myrtle Point at 3: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
